非关系型数据库以独特架构存储数据,区别于传统关系型数据库。其优势在于灵活的数据模型、可扩展性和高性能,适用于处理大量、高速变化的数据,是现代大数据和云计算的重要存储解决方案。
本文目录导读:
图片来源于网络,如有侵权联系删除
随着互联网技术的飞速发展,大数据时代已经来临,在这个时代背景下,非关系型数据库应运而生,凭借其独特的存储结构,成为企业应对海量数据挑战的重要工具,本文将深入剖析非关系型数据库的存储结构,揭示其优势,并探讨其在实际应用中的价值。
非关系型数据库存储结构概述
非关系型数据库(NoSQL)与传统的关系型数据库相比,其存储结构具有以下特点:
1、分布式存储:非关系型数据库采用分布式存储方式,将数据分散存储在多个节点上,提高了数据存储的可靠性和可扩展性。
2、数据模型:非关系型数据库支持多种数据模型,如键值对(Key-Value)、文档、列族、图等,满足不同场景下的数据存储需求。
3、高度可扩展:非关系型数据库采用水平扩展策略,通过增加节点数量来提升系统性能,适应大数据时代的挑战。
4、无模式设计:非关系型数据库无需预先定义数据结构,支持动态添加和修改字段,提高了数据存储的灵活性。
图片来源于网络,如有侵权联系删除
非关系型数据库存储结构优势
1、高性能:非关系型数据库采用分布式存储,数据读写速度快,能够满足高并发、大数据量场景下的需求。
2、可扩展性:非关系型数据库支持水平扩展,可根据业务需求灵活调整存储资源,降低系统升级成本。
3、高可用性:分布式存储方式提高了数据备份和恢复能力,确保系统在发生故障时仍能正常运行。
4、灵活性:无模式设计使得非关系型数据库能够适应业务变化,降低数据迁移和维护成本。
5、灵活的查询语言:非关系型数据库支持多种查询语言,如MongoDB的JSON查询、Cassandra的CQL等,方便用户进行数据操作。
非关系型数据库在实际应用中的价值
1、大数据存储:非关系型数据库能够高效存储和处理海量数据,成为大数据时代的重要基础设施。
图片来源于网络,如有侵权联系删除
2、高并发场景:非关系型数据库支持高并发读写,适用于电商、社交、在线教育等高并发场景。
3、分布式系统:非关系型数据库支持分布式存储,有助于构建分布式系统,提高系统性能和可靠性。
4、实时数据处理:非关系型数据库能够实时处理数据,适用于物联网、实时监控等场景。
5、跨平台应用:非关系型数据库支持多种编程语言和开发框架,便于跨平台应用开发。
非关系型数据库存储结构具有独特的优势,能够满足大数据时代的数据存储需求,随着技术的不断发展,非关系型数据库将在更多领域发挥重要作用,成为企业应对数据挑战的重要工具。
评论列表